Block work repair services involve the restoration and reinforcement of masonry made from concrete blocks, bricks, or similar materials. These services typically address issues such as cracked, crumbling, or damaged blocks that can compromise the structural integrity and appearance of a property. Skilled contractors use specialized techniques to replace broken or deteriorated blocks, fill in cracks, and ensure the overall stability of the wall or foundation. Proper repair not only enhances the look of the property but also helps prevent further damage that could lead to costly repairs down the line.
Many common problems can signal the need for block work repairs. These include visible cracks in walls, loose or shifting blocks, water infiltration, or signs of deterioration like spalling or crumbling surfaces. Such issues can arise from settling foundations, exposure to moisture, or general wear over time. Addressing these problems early with professional repairs can help maintain the safety and durability of the property, whether it’s a residential home, basement, retaining wall, or commercial building.

The overview below groups typical Block Work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Newton, NC.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or block work repairs, such as patching or replacing a few damaged bricks,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age and materials used.
Moderate Projects - Larger repairs involving partial wall rebuilding or extensive patchwork can cost between $600-$2,500. These projects are common for homeowners addressing significant cracks or deteriorated sections in their masonry.
Full Wall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of a section or entire wall often range from $2,500-$5,000, with some larger or more complex jobs reaching higher. Fewer projects reach this tier, typically involving structural issues or extensive damage.
Large-Scale Installations - Major new block work installations or extensive structural repairs can exceed $5,000, depending on size and complexity. Local contractors can provide estimates for these larger projects based on specific site conditions and project scope.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When evaluating contractors for block work repair services, it’s important to consider their experience with similar projects. Homeowners should inquire about how long a local contractor has been working on masonry repairs and whether they have handled projects comparable in scope and complexity. An experienced professional will be familiar with the specific challenges that can arise with block work, such as foundation stability or weather-related issues, and will be better equipped to deliver quality results. Gathering information about a contractor’s past work can help ensure that their expertise aligns with the needs of the repair project.
Clear, written expectations are essential when selecting a service provider for block work repairs. Homeowners should seek detailed proposals that outline the scope of work, materials to be used, and any specific steps involved in the repair process. Having these details in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and provides a reference point throughout the project. Reputable local contractors will be transparent about their process and willing to discuss the details, ensuring everyone is on the same page before work begins.
